Overview

The American elephantfish, commonly referred to as the cockfish, is a species of chimaera belonging to the family Callorhinchidae.

Best Baits & Lures

Live Baits

  • Squid

    Cut squid is a common and effective bait.

  • Shrimp

    Use fresh or frozen shrimp.

  • Pilchards

    Cut pilchards can be very effective.

  • Mussels

    A readily available and attractive bait.

  • Cockles

    Another effective shellfish bait.

Techniques

Target Plownose chimaera by fishing near the seabed in deeper coastal waters, using a slow retrieve or jigging action to entice strikes.
